Just found a gold mine if you&#039;re interested in historic VM. Documentary Educational Resources is releasing DVDs from the Screening Room Series, which includes John Whitney, Brakhage, and others. In the Whitney,&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;a href=&quot;http://www.der.org/films/screening-room-john-whitney.html&quot;&gt;http://www.der.org/films/screening-room-john-whitney.html&lt;/a&gt;&lt;br /&gt;
John talks about his work and plays several films, most with music (Matrix, Permutations, et al.)&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
Also received Brakhage and Breer today but haven&#039;t had time to check them out.&lt;br /&gt;
Not a lot of money for home use, but institutional is really expensive.&lt;br /&gt;
